The god delusion is a 2006 book by english biologist richard dawkins, a professorial fellow at new college, oxford, and former holder of the charles simonyi chair for the public understanding of science at the university of oxford in the god delusion, dawkins contends that a supernatural creator almost certainly does not exist and that belief in a personal god qualifies as a delusion. Richard dawkins bestselling nonfiction book the god delusion has not only been translated into arabic by iraqi translator bassam albaghdadi, but its pdf version has also been downloaded 10 million times, with at least 30 percent of all downloads being made in saudi arabia.
